GOOD WORKS

Hello, this is Cardinal Rigali. Mother Teresa of Calcutta once said, "Good works are links that form a chain of love." It is important for us to do good works because it is an outward expression of our love for others. There are so many people in the world who need our help - the homebound elderly, the sick and dying, and the poor and hungry.

Good works are also vital to living the Gospel message that Jesus preached: "Whatever  you did for one of these least brothers of mine, you did for me." (Matt. 25:40)

God calls all of us to do good works, however small. I encourage you to seek opportunities to be the kind of person that Mother Teresa talked about by doing good works and being a link in the chain of love in our world today.

May God bless you all.
